Should I Take an At-Home UTI Test? | POPSUGAR Fitness


An At-Home UTI Test Should Never Replace a Visit to Your Doctor Here s Why

When you think you may have a UTI, it s best practice to call up your doctor and get into the office for testing. However, there may be a part of you wondering if you can skip that trip and use an at-home UTI test to confirm the issue for yourself instead.
The short answer? An at-home UTI test should never replace an actual doctor s appointment.
According to Wai Lee, MD, the director of Female Pelvic Medicine and Reconstructive Surgery at the Northwell Smith Institute for Urology, at-home UTI tests function similarly to urine dip-stick test strips, which are designed to flag specific markers that can suggest you have a UTI, such as nitrite (a chemical produced by some bacteria that cause UTIs) and leukocytes (white blood cells that fight off infection). ....

City of P.A. urges residents to stop putting face masks in the blue bin


Prince Albert’s sanitation manager is urging residents to dispose of face masks in the garbage, not the blue bin.
Not only are the face coverings not recyclable, but they’re hazardous for the workers who sort the city’s recycling, Nisar Ghani told
paNOW.
Sometimes entire loads of recycling are diverted to the landfill because they are contaminated with face masks. As a result, the amount of material in Prince Albert’s blue bins that actually gets recycled has decreased 15 per cent over the pandemic, Ghani said.
“Regularly, 75 per cent gets recycled,” he explained. “During the pandemic it’s come down to 60 [per cent] because of the masks.” ....
